Output ede308270b6f63c9fda44c27b56fb757ee560f21b4f5ff2e9fa49225034d2d60:0

value
73243181732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173dbf4e9b5c71653b86bedaef5bc84f0fa864e4 OP_EQUAL
address
MA23k7t2NiQXkLMzpzkpeKgUoETwFuagag
transaction
ede308270b6f63c9fda44c27b56fb757ee560f21b4f5ff2e9fa49225034d2d60
spent
true